LEMONY HEARTS OF PALM SALAD

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Time 20m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 0



Lemony Hearts of Palm Salad image

Steps:

  • Soak 1/4 cup sliced red onion in cold water, 10 minutes; drain. Toss with 2 cups sliced hearts of palm, 1 cup sliced celery and some chopped parsley. Add 3 tablespoons each lemon juice and olive oil. Season with salt and pepper. Serve over arugula drizzled with olive oil.

HEARTS OF PALM SALAD

This salad is very easy to make and always requested by my family. People think they are eating something special because it is made with hearts of palm. Best if chilled overnight.

Provided by HEATHER SG

Categories     Salad     Vegetable Salad Recipes

Time 30m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 8



Hearts of Palm Salad image

Steps:

  • In a medium bowl, whisk together the dressing mix, vinegar, and water until well blended. Whisk in olive oil. Add hearts of palm to the bowl, and stir to coat. Cover and refrigerate for at least one hour or overnight.
  • Before serving, sprinkle the green and black olives, and bacon bits over the salad.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 317.4 calories, Carbohydrate 4.7 g, Cholesterol 1.3 mg, Fat 33.3 g, Fiber 1.2 g, Protein 1.6 g, SaturatedFat 4.6 g, Sodium 1755.1 mg, Sugar 2.6 g

3 (14.25 ounce) cans hearts of palm, drained and sliced
2 (.7 ounce) packages dry Italian-style salad dressing mix
½ cup white wine or champagne vinegar
6 tablespoons water
1 cup olive oil
1 (8 ounce) jar green olives, sliced
1 (6 ounce) can sliced black olives
2 tablespoons bacon bits

HEARTS OF PALM AND CHICKPEA SALAD

This is a nice, simple salad that requires a minimum of effort and no actual cooking...always nice on hot summer days. As with most vegetable salads, amounts are approximate (I often trade the tomatoes for carrots or peas).

Provided by Aunt Cookie

Categories     Beans

Time 15m

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11



Hearts of Palm and Chickpea Salad image

Steps:

  • Toss together all salad ingredients.
  • Whisk dressing ingredients in a small bowl.
  • Toss vegetables with dressing until thoroughly combined.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 200.5, Fat 10.6, SaturatedFat 1.4, Sodium 566.4, Carbohydrate 23.3, Fiber 5.7, Sugar 1.6, Protein 5.3

1 1/4 cups canned chick-peas, drained
1 cup coarsely chopped tomatoes
3/4 cup hearts of palm, cut into 1 inch pieces
3/4 cup pitted black olives, halved
1/4 cup chopped scallion
1/4 cup chopped parsley
2 tablespoons olive oil
2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
1 small garlic clove, minced
1/4 teaspoon dried oregano
1/4 teaspoon pepper
